Deborah Dzurnik Halley: NIZSNIK
Looking for information on Maria Nisznik (Niznik) born Podvilk about 1873. She married Adalbert Kurzeja in Budapest in 1897. They had 3 children. They came to USA, first to Michigan, then to Chicago, Illinois, USA. Adalbert died 1917 and Maria then married Janos Dutta.

Zlatica: Re: NIZSNIK
Deborah

How do you know that Maria married Adalbert KURZEJA in Budapest? They sure were far from home.
If you look at KURZEJAs that came thru Ellis Island, none were from Budapest.
Your ancestors do have a Slavic surnames. Our ancestors married within same region, religion (few exceptions) but for sure one common language/dialect to communicate in.
Most likely KURZEJA was from the same area of Podvilk/Podwilk.
